Willow Raises $7M Seed
Willow, located in Herzliya, Israel, is an identity and access platform for enterprise AI agents that has emerged from stealth with $7 million in seed funding. The company provides a governance and access layer that grants organizations full visibility and control over how AI agents connect to internal systems and the actions they perform.
Investors
The round was led by Hetz Ventures, with participation from early angel investors Avishai Abrahami and Nir Zohar.
Willow Use of Funds
The company plans to use the funding to enhance the next phase of its go-to-market strategy and to accelerate its ongoing product development efforts.
About Willow
Founded in 2026 by former Wix engineers Eyal Ben Ezra, Shalev Shalit, and Idan Chetrit, Willow helps enterprises safely adopt AI agents across the workplace. The company's platform allows organizations to securely connect AI agents to internal systems with runtime permissions, centralized controls, auditability, and full attribution of agent activity. Willow is headquartered in Herzliya, Israel.
